## Step 3: Pin the Component Library Version

As of Brindlewick UI v4, shared components no longer float on the latest minor release. Each consuming app must pin an exact version in its manifest before upgrading. Skipping this step causes mismatched theme tokens at build time. Update your manifest to match the values below, then rerun the bundler.

deployment values, tahaf-fajog:
[ralmir]
host = ralmir.paliqcorp.internal
user = ralmir_svc
database = ralmir_prod

## Runbook: Sproutline watering scheduler — stalled runs

If greenhouse operators report dry beds, first confirm the Sproutline scheduler actually fired: check the last-run timestamp in the admin panel. A common cause is the moisture-sensor poll timing out, which silently skips the cycle rather than failing loudly. Do not manually trigger watering more than once per hour, as valves can overlap. Compare the live settings against the expected configuration shown below.

service settings:
novath:
  pin: 1396
  tenant: pelys
  seal: seal_ccc035e1
  metrics_host: metrics.novath.qorvelworks.test
  standby_team: fraeth
  escalation: drueth-zorok
  nonce: 61d508

- [ ] **Step 7: Breaker override escrow.** After sealing the signing keys for the Tallgrove upstream API circuit breaker, confirm the support team can force the breaker open during a full outage. The override bundle lives in the sealed escrow drawer and is useless without its unlock phrase. Two ceremony witnesses must initial this step before proceeding. The escrow bundle is decrypted with the recovery passphrase that follows.

vault phrase of kahip-kahop = holath-quenmir